Default re-ring or wait?

I have a built 383 that is consuming an alarmingly larger amount of oil. Probably around 1qt/1k There are no ostensible external leaks, and there is oil stains on the bumper from the exhaust. It doesn't always smoke at idle; although, it does occasionally. It does, however, smoke under WOT.

I plan to do a compression test whenever I have the time, but what else can I do, especially if the compression tests fine?
